// "typeof" operator implementation
//
// Described in CUJ 20(8, 10, and 12), August, October, and December 2002:  "A Bit-Wise Typeof"
// This version is a re-write of the original implementation that employs the typeint implementation
// of extended precision compile time arithmetic.  Typeints are described in CUJ online experts
// column, February 2003.
